F# is a functional-first programming language developed by Microsoft Research and first appeared in 2005. Known for its strong focus on functional programming paradigms, F# combines the power of functional programming with the flexibility of object-oriented programming. It is designed to be a general-purpose language that can be used for a wide range of applications, from web development to data processing.
As a member of the Languages category, F# falls into the realm of programming languages that emphasize functional programming concepts such as immutability and higher-order functions. Programmers who use F# often appreciate its concise syntax, type inference capabilities, and powerful features for asynchronous and parallel programming. F# is commonly used in areas such as data analysis, scientific computing, and financial modeling where functional programming principles are particularly beneficial.

F# is a powerful and versatile programming language that companies choose for its unique set of advantages. With its functional-first approach and strong typing system, F# offers a range of benefits that set it apart from other similar technologies, making it a popular choice for companies looking to build robust and efficient software solutions.
F# promotes a functional programming paradigm, which simplifies code structure and promotes code reuse. This leads to increased developer productivity as tasks can be accomplished with fewer lines of code compared to traditional imperative languages like C#. The concise syntax of F# allows developers to express complex concepts more efficiently, reducing the likelihood of bugs and errors in the codebase.
F# leverages strong type inference capabilities, enabling developers to write code with fewer explicit type annotations. This not only reduces boilerplate code but also enhances code readability and maintainability. By automatically deducing types, F# allows for more flexible and concise code, ultimately improving the overall development experience and reducing the risk of type-related issues.
As an open-source language developed by Microsoft, F# seamlessly integrates with the .NET ecosystem, providing access to a wide range of libraries and frameworks. This interoperability enables companies to leverage existing .NET components and tools within their F# projects, streamlining development processes and facilitating integration with other Microsoft technologies.
F# includes built-in support for asynchronous and parallel programming, making it well-suited for developing concurrent and scalable applications. By offering lightweight asynchronous workflows and immutable data structures, F# simplifies the handling of concurrency, enabling companies to build responsive and high-performance software systems more efficiently than with traditional imperative languages.
In summary, companies use F# for its enhanced productivity, strong type inference capabilities, seamless integration with the .NET ecosystem, and robust support for concurrency, making it a valuable choice for developing modern software solutions.
F# is a functional-first programming language that is gaining popularity for its concise syntax and powerful capabilities. Several prominent companies have adopted F# in their tech stack to leverage its benefits. Here are some case studies highlighting how companies are using F# effectively:
Jet.com: Jet.com, an e-commerce company owned by Walmart, utilizes F# for developing high-performance pricing algorithms. By leveraging F#'s functional programming features, Jet.com was able to streamline their pricing calculations, resulting in faster and more accurate pricing strategies. The company started using F# in 2016 and has since seen significant improvements in their pricing optimization processes.
AdRoll: AdRoll, a prominent digital marketing platform, has incorporated F# into their ad bidding system. F# provides AdRoll with the ability to handle complex real-time bidding computations efficiently. The functional nature of F# allows AdRoll to manage bid requests effectively, leading to improved ad targeting and performance. AdRoll integrated F# into their tech stack in 2015, enhancing their ad serving capabilities.
Stack Overflow: Stack Overflow, the popular question and answer website for developers, relies on F# for data analysis and machine learning tasks. F# enables Stack Overflow to process vast amounts of data efficiently and derive valuable insights to enhance user experience. By leveraging the functional programming paradigm of F#, Stack Overflow started using the language in 2014 and continues to benefit from its capabilities in data-driven decision-making processes.
These case studies illustrate how companies across different industries leverage F# to enhance their operations, drive innovation, and achieve competitive advantages. By strategically incorporating F# into their tech stacks, companies can harness the power of functional programming to solve complex problems effectively.
